Why Industrial TFT Displays Are Essential in Harsh Environments

In industrial automation, reliability isn’t optional — it’s a must. Harsh conditions like extreme temperatures, dust, vibration, and intense ambient light demand specialized hardware. That’s where industrial-grade TFT displays come into play.

These displays go far beyond consumer-grade screens. Designed for durability, readability, and long-term operation, they are at the core of many mission-critical embedded systems.

What Makes Industrial TFT LCDs Different?

Industrial TFT displays are engineered for the field — not the living room. Here’s what sets them apart:
• Wide Operating Temperature: Typically -30°C to +85°C
• High Brightness: 800 to 1500 nits for sunlight readability
• Enhanced Lifespan: 5–10 years of continuous use
• Custom Interfaces: LVDS, RGB, MIPI-DSI, or SPI
• Optical Bonding: Improves outdoor visibility and durability

Unlike consumer displays that are optimized for cost and aesthetics, industrial panels focus on reliability, visibility, and environmental endurance.

Where Are They Used?

Industrial TFTs are common across a wide range of sectors:
• Factory Automation: Human-Machine Interfaces (HMIs) on shop floors
• Medical Equipment: Portable ultrasound devices, patient monitors
• Outdoor Terminals: Charging stations, kiosks, vending machines
• Embedded Systems: HVAC controllers, vehicle dashboards, IoT gateways

Their flexibility in size, touch integration, and power efficiency makes them ideal for both fixed and portable designs.
